I have a cat at home and when I'm cooking he's right by my feet trying to get the food. So what kinds of "people" food can cats eat?

Steamed vegetables like carrots, broccoli, green beans and chopped greens can be fed to cats. Cheese, fish, eggs and meat are also human foods that can be fed on cats. However, do not feed cats on onions, grapes and raisins, garlic, chocolate or alcoholic drinks even if it is small proportions.
